The Gronkowski Family

Claim to Fame: If you know Patriots tight end, twerking aficionado, and cruise mogul Rob Gronkowski, you probably know his crew—father Gordie and brothers Chris, Glenn, Dan, and Gordie Jr.—too. Perhaps you saw them on Family Feud. Maybe you’ve taken a Gronk Fitness class. Possibly you’ve even taken a spin on the Gronk Bus. In short: These guys are everywhere.

What They Eat: It shouldn’t be surprising that a family that does everything together also favors the same breakfasts. They often whip up scrambled eggs with veggies (above); Greek yogurt with strawberries; or buttermilk flavored-P28 protein pancakes with turkey sausage. If they work out in the morning, they opt for vanilla protein shakes with banana or peanut butter.

Why They Eat Them: Dan Gronkowski keeps it short and sweet when describing the value of a solid breakfast: “A good breakfast can fuel your workout and your entire day,” he says. Amen.
